Washington Calls Kalshi’s Wager

  • Washington AG Nick Brown sued KalshiEx LLC (Kalshi), alleging its online “prediction market” platform operates as an illegal gambling business under Washington law.
  • According to the complaint, Kalshi allegedly markets prohibited online sports wagers and other “event contracts” to Washingtonians on topics ranging from NFL games to measles case counts, while rebranding gambling as a lawful “predictive market.” The complaint also alleges Kalshi uses affiliated market makers to play a role similar to the house in traditional gambling models, even though Washington broadly bans internet gambling outside narrow exceptions.
  • The lawsuit seeks a permanent injunction to halt the platform’s operations in the state, along with restitution, disgorgement, civil penalties, an accounting, and recovery of money allegedly lost by Washington residents.
  • We previously reported on similar lawsuits, including, among others, those filed by Massachusetts AG Andrea Joy Campbell and Michigan AG Dana Nessel, alleging Kalshi violated state gambling laws.
